CHEMICAL WATER TREATMENT FOR COOLING TOWERS AND SYSTEMS

Water cooling is a method of heat removal from components and industrial equipment. As opposed to air coolingwater is used as the heat conductor. Water cooling is commonly used for cooling automobile internal combustion engines and large industrial facilities such as steam electric power plantshydroelectric generatorspetroleum refineries and chemical plantsOther uses include cooling the barrels of machine guns, cooling of lubricant oil in pumps; for cooling purposes in heat exchangers; cooling products from tanks or columns, and recently, cooling of various major components inside high-end personal computers such as CPUsGPUs, and motherboards. The main mechanism for water cooling is convective heat transfer.

Our chemical programs are effectively used for the reduction and prevention of the three major issues your industrial cooling water system may encounter corrosion, deposition, and microbial growth. Corrosion leads to metal loss that can result in critical system failures in heat exchangers, recirculating water piping, and process cooling equipment. Corrosion also results in a loss of efficiency as corrosion products precipitate on heat transfer devices, insulating the metals.

OPTIMIZING COOLING SYSTEM EFFICIENCY

Biological organisms, including algae, bacteria, protozoa, and fungi, often find their breeding grounds in cooling towers. If not properly controlled, biological growth forms and acts as a natural adhesion surface for scale formation, resulting in fouling. All of these conditions can be seriously problematic when it comes to optimizing the efficiency of your cooling water tower or system.
